Overview

Kepler-511 b is an exoplanet orbiting the star Kepler-511, discovered in 2016 using the Transit method. It is a Neptune-sized world.

System Context

Kepler-511 b orbits Kepler-511 and was reported in 2016 and was detected with the Transit method.

Published measurements list a radius of 6.35 Earth radii, a mass of 35.24 Earth masses (estimated), and an orbital period of 296.64 days.

Catalog data places the system at about 652 parsecs from Earth and 2 known planets in the system.
